Lot 102
A Tasmanian Picture
watercolour and gouache on paper
signed lower right: BLAMIRE YOUNG
inscribed verso: A TASMANIAN PICTURE/ DR G M GILLIES/ given to/ 1974 DR + MRS SHEPHERD
54 x 77cm
Estimate $3,500 - $5,500
In good condition consistent with age. Colours appear strong and unaffected by fading. Areas of foxing evident in the lower right and centre specifically. Some small spots also on the underside of the glass.
The frame is likely original, with losses to the ornate trimming. The artwork has not been inspected outside of its frame.
Backing card verso displays signs of wear, and abbrasion as with age.
